Master the Fundamentals of Firearm Safety
Every certified instructor emphasizes these core principles. Understanding and practicing these rules is essential to responsible firearm ownership.
Always Keep Muzzle Pointed Safe
This is the golden rule of firearm safety. Always be aware of where the barrel is pointing at every moment. Never point it at anything you are not willing to destroy. This rule applies whether the firearm is loaded or unloaded.
Keep Finger Off Trigger
Keep your finger off the trigger until the moment you are ready to fire. Your trigger finger should remain outside the trigger guard until your sights are on target and you have committed to shooting. This prevents accidental discharge.
Be Certain of Target
Know what your target is and what lies beyond it. Understand your surroundings and what could be affected by your shot. Be aware of people, obstacles, and terrain. This responsibility continues even after you have fired.
Additional Safety Guidelines We Cover
Assume every firearm is loaded at all times
Use proper eye and ear protection at all times
Inspect your firearm regularly for proper function
Store firearms securely and keep ammunition separate
Never use alcohol or drugs when handling firearms
Train regularly to maintain and improve skills
